Pytania otagowane jako c

C jest uniwersalnym językiem programowania komputerowego używanym do systemów operacyjnych, gier i innych prac wymagających wysokiej wydajności.


3
Bez blokady IPC w systemie Linux dla procesorów wielordzeniowych
Próbuję znaleźć sposób na napisanie aplikacji bez blokady IPC na Linuksie, w C, z procesorami wielordzeniowymi. Załóżmy, że mam proces 1 i proces 2, które zapisują w FIFO lub w pamięci współdzielonej. Następnie proces 3 i proces 4 będą czytać z tej pamięci współdzielonej lub FIFO. Czy jest to możliwe …




6
Gdzie w systemie obiektowym powinieneś, jeśli w ogóle, wybierać struktury (w stylu C) zamiast klas?
C i najprawdopodobniej wiele innych języków zapewnia structsłowo kluczowe do tworzenia struktur (lub czegoś podobnego). Są to (przynajmniej w C), z uproszczonego punktu widzenia, takie jak klasy, ale bez polimorfizmu, dziedziczenia, metod itd. Pomyśl o zorientowanym obiektowo (lub paradygmacie) języku o strukturach typu C. Gdzie wybrałbyś je zamiast klas? Teraz …
Korzystając z naszej strony potwierdzasz, że przeczytałeś(-aś) i rozumiesz nasze zasady używania plików cookie i zasady ochrony prywatności.
Licensed under cc by-sa 3.0 with attribution required.